Konadu ropes in Abdulai Gazale as first assistant coach at Kotoko

Young coach, Abdulai Gazale is joining the backroom of new Asante Kotoko boss Maxwell Konadu as first assistant.

The ex-Gomoa Feteh Feyenoord (now WAFA SC) player’s impending job with the Porcupines is upon the express request of Konadu who re-joined the club on a two-year renewable contract on Monday.

Kotoko already have two assistant coaches – Johnson Smith and Akakpo Patron – both Caf License B holders and the new head coach has decided to keep them on his return.

“Currently nobody is leaving the technical team; we are all going to work together to achieve our targets. If we make wholesale changes, it means we are going to start slowly from scratch,” Konadu said.

He added: “I’m only adding one additional member and he is Abdulai Gazale who is based in Tamale. In terms of documentation, Gazale has the License A so automatically, he is ahead of everybody else in the technical team.”

Abdulai Gazale is one of the last batch of coaches to undergo the Caf License A course organized by the GFA in 2016.

Meanwhile, coach Maxwell Konadu is scheduled to be unveiled by Kotoko at the club’s Adako Jachie Training centre at 14:00 GMT Wednesday.
